How much do entry level assistant project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level assistant project manager in Miami, FL is $43,537.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$36,900.00 and $47,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an entry level assistant project manager?

An Entry Level Assistant Project Manager supports project managers in planning, coordinating, and executing projects within a company. They assist with scheduling, budgeting, documentation, and communication to ensure projects stay on track. This role is ideal for individuals looking to gain experience in project management while developing leadership and organizational skills. Duties may include preparing reports, tracking project progress, and collaborating with team members to meet deadlines.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an entry level assistant project manager?

As an Entry Level Assistant Project Manager, your daily tasks may include coordinating project schedules, updating documentation, attending team meetings, and communicating with stakeholders to ensure everyone is aligned. You might also assist with tracking project progress, preparing status reports, and identifying or addressing minor issues as they arise. Working closely with senior project managers and team members, you’ll gain hands-on experience in project planning and execution. This role is ideal for those who enjoy collaborating, problem-solving, and learning in a dynamic environ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the entry level assistant project manager position?

To excel as an Entry Level Assistant Project Manager, you typically need a bachelor’s degree in a relevant field, str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of project management principles. Familiarity with project management software such as Microsoft Project, Asana, or Trello, and basic knowledge of tools like Excel, is often required. Strong communication, teamwork, and willingness to learn set outstanding candidates apart. These skills are essential to ensure projects stay on track, tasks are coordinated effectively, and both team and client expectations are met.

Can I be an entry level assistant project manager?

Entry level assistant project managers typically do not require extensive experience and often have a bachelor's degree in a related field such as business or engineering. Strong organizational, communication, and basic project management skills are important, and some roles may prefer familiarity with project management tools like MS Project or Trello. Certifications like CAPM can also enhance eligibility for entry-level positions.

How to become an entry level assistant project manager with no experience?

To become an entry-level assistant project manager with no experience, candidates should focus on developing basic project management skills, such as organization and communication, often through relevant coursework or certifications like CAPM. Gaining familiarity with project management tools and gaining experience through internships or entry-level roles in related fields can also improve prospects for this position.

Job description

About the Job:
The Rinaldi Group, LLC., a high-rise builder of residential structures, hotels, and office buildings, is seeking a highly skilled individual as an Assistant Project Manager.
 
 Requirements:
  • The candidate must be well versed and experienced with all 16-AIA trade classifications of construction and building, most particularly, Site Logistics & Site Safety in coordination and conjunction with the DOB/DOT/FD, and Con Edison, in addition to SOE, Concrete Foundation, Concrete Superstructure, Building Envelope, Elevators & MEPS.
  • Minimum 2 years experience as an Assistant Project Manager in commercial residential, hotel, and office building construction projects 
  • Candidate must be a highly motivated, cost-conscious, organized, multi-tasker with good communication and paperwork skills including job reporting, weekly progress job meetings, and dealing directly with Owners & Design Teams in addition to the Trades.
  • Must be hands-on and capable versed in and experienced using Microsoft Office with knowledge and familiarity using Project Management software such as Sage, Primavera or MS Projects, Procore, Submittal Exchange, and/or other similar programs.
  • Candidate must have the ability to handle Submittals and RFIs for the project and demonstrate specific experience with Submittals and RFIs in the interview process. 
  • Candidate must also have the ability to work in a high-energy, fast-paced environment.
  • More importantly, an individual must be a loyal, committed company-man type of employee and teammate.

 Core Responsibilities:
  • Working with the Pre-con Team, including the Estimating Department in developing project budgets and schedules and especially writing and building upon boiler-place Scope-of-Work sheets.
  • Working with Estimating & Purchasing in preparing & writing Trade Scopes-of-Work and Contract Documents, including but not limited to the creating and recording of Drawing Logs, Specification Manifests & Qualification Sheets.
  • Preparing, organizing & submitting Monthly Statistical Reports for Owners & their Lenders, encompassing Progress Reporting & Outline, RFI-Logs, Bulletin Logs, CO Logs, Submittal Logs, Cost-Control Reports, including Contingency transfers & allocation, and Man-power Reports.
  • Writing, maintaining, and updating their own Meeting Minutes for Owner Progress Meetings, Subcontractor & Vendor Coordination Meetings, and Safety/Tool-Box Meetings.
  • Preparing, scheduling & expediting 3rd Party inspections & testing.
  • Assisting in the development and implementation of operating processes and strategies.
  • Procuring & scheduling materials & equipment deliveries, providing activities scheduling & input for the in-house scheduler, and preparing & submitting each day, daily reports, time-sheets, and/or manpower logs.
  • Full-time on-site supervision over ALL construction activities.
  • Organizing the project team and task assignments.
  • Must oversee all project activities, including subcontractors & vendors, staff scheduling, trade coordination, and compliance with DOB & OSHA safety rules & regulations.
  • Must have the ability to push a Project Schedule along with the Trade contractors and their respective project teams.  Must have a strong personality with good leadership skills and field generalship, capable of directing the different work activities and crews.
 
The firm has had steady growth over the past 15 years with a current book of business of over $ 750 million.  Positions are permanent hire with full benefits and no employee participation, including 401-K and full Health, Dental & Prescription Eyeglass coverage, including Life & Disability Insurance packages as well; the Salary range will be commensurate with experience and educational background.
